Sat 702434275054631

decimal
140486.4275054631
degree
0°140486′1382″4275054631‴
percentile
33.449251229871855%
name
iwjkunfogba
cycle
0
epoch
0
period
69
block
140486
offset
4275054631
timestamp
rarity
common